Bumps rimraf from 3.0.2 to 4.1.0.
Changelog
Sourced from rimraf's changelog.
v4.1
- Improved hybrid module with no need to look at the
.default
dangly bit..default
preserved as a reference torimraf
for compatibility with anyone who came to rely on it in v4.0.v4.0
- Remove
glob
dependency entirely. This library now only accepts actual file and folder names to delete.- Accept array of paths or single path.
- Windows performance and reliability improved.
- All strategies separated into explicitly exported methods.
- Drop support for Node.js below version 14
- rewrite in TypeScript
- ship CJS/ESM hybrid module
v3.0
- Add
--preserve-root
option to executable (default true)- Drop support for Node.js below version 6
v2.7
- Make
glob
an optional dependency2.6
- Retry on EBUSY on non-windows platforms as well
- Make
rimraf.sync
10000% more reliable on Windows2.5
- Handle Windows EPERM when lstat-ing read-only dirs
- Add glob option to pass options to glob
2.4
- Add EPERM to delay/retry loop
- Add
disableGlob
option2.3
- Make maxBusyTries and emfileWait configurable
- Handle weird SunOS unlink-dir issue
- Glob the CLI arg for better Windows support
2.2
- Handle ENOENT properly on Windows
